The kind of key your car has will determine how much it costs to replace. Modern cars typically come with transponder chips that need to be paired by an auto locksmith or a dealer. Transferring these codes can be extremely expensive and Car Key Cutting service is a major element in the price of a replacement car key.
Duplicating a standard-sized key with cuts around the edges is the least costly option. This type of key is easy to create and does not require encoding. Keys that are standard in size usually cost only a few dollars to cut. Keys cut with lasers, on the other hand are milled around the edges or along the center of the key with the help of a laser. This is more precise and takes longer than standard cutting. The price of a key laser cut could be as high as $50 and varies based on location.
Many people are familiar with the traditional car keys that have cuts along the edges of the key. These keys are designed for Car Key Cutting service older models of car and do not have chips. Those who have newer cars with transponder chips in their key fobs will have to shell out more money to have them copied. The key fobs can be expensive, and they have to be programmed.
A key fob is a small device that can unlock your car and lock it when you park it, and then start the engine. The most popular fobs are made by major auto manufacturers. Some have buttons that allow you to control the radio, lights, or even the phone while driving the vehicle. Some key fobs are equipped with sensors that monitor the vehicle's location and other systems.

If you've lost your car keys, a solution like key cutting can help get on the road again. However, there are a few things that you should know before deciding to get an extra car key. First of all, it is crucial to know the type of key you have. There are a variety of keys and each requires a unique process for cutting. Certain keys need to be programmed to work with your car. This can make it more expensive for key replacement.
The most basic keys are traditional brass keys, and they're easy to cut. You can buy key blanks online or in most hardware stores. However, if you're planning to create a high-security key, the process is more complicated and will cost more. These keys feature more intricate cuts that are difficult to reproduce with traditional key cutters. They also have an RF chip molded into the key's end. The chip communicates with the vehicle. This technology makes it very difficult to connect a vehicle with hot wires.

In the past, car keys came in a variety of styles and types. Some keys have advanced features that improve security and make it more difficult to duplicate or steal. For example, some have an encrypted transponder chip that connects to the vehicle's immobilizer system to stop access by anyone else.
Other keys come with special electronics like remote start or push-to-start systems that require an electronic key fob. This type of key will cost more to cut because the technician has to program the key into the car's computer system. This can be a difficult process, and costs will vary based on the car model.
Another aspect to consider when choosing a car key cutting service is the price of the machine itself. A duplicator of high quality could cost a few thousand dollars and is more expensive than buying keys from an auto dealer. It is also unlikely to pay for itself when you only need to cut a few keys each year. It is best to purchase a blank key that costs less in the long run.
The transponder-chip car key is by far the most expensive. These keys are also called proximity or smart and come with advanced anti-theft technologies. They transmit a signal the car responds to with the unique key code. Only a key that is properly-coded can start the vehicle. However, the key must be programmed to work with a specific vehicle and this can be done at the dealership or by locksmiths. This process can be time-consuming and expensive, but it's worth it to be able to use a key effectively.

There are a few different kinds of car key cutting machines each with its own unique features. Some are more expensive, however, they all can create a key with precision and precision. One alternative is a manual machine which makes use of the key tracer along with a cutter wheel to create keys. It's not difficult to operate, but it requires a steady hand and full concentration.
Another option is an automated key-cutting machine for cars. It holds the key in place while it cuts and produces more than one key at a time. It is a great option for businesses that need to produce multiple copies of the identical key quickly and accurately. This machine allows you to duplicate keys in just a few minutes, which saves time and money.
Certain keys are more complicated than others and require special codes to be copied correctly. These keys are called transponder keys, or smart keys and have an embedded electronic chip that communicates with a car's ignition to allow the vehicle to start. This makes them much harder to steal and gives them an extra layer of security. They aren't difficult to steal, but they are more expensive to duplicate.
